How a claim runs
Liability
The other insurer investigates and admits or denies. Days where it is obvious, months where it is fought.
Your vehicle
Inspection, then repair or a total loss valuation. We chase both.
Settlement
Your losses are pursued and settled. We keep you told where it has got to.

Yes. Almost every policy requires you to notify them of any accident, even where you are not claiming on your own cover. Notifying is not the same as claiming.
It should not. The claim runs against the other driver’s insurer, so your own policy is left alone.
No. We handle the vehicle side. If you have been injured we can put you in touch with a firm of solicitors who act for you, and we receive no payment for doing so.
A vehicle-only claim with liability admitted can settle in a few weeks. Disputed liability adds months. We will give you an honest view once we know the facts.
